草庐IT

ACTION_SET_ALARM

全部标签

win10下执行Hadoop命令报错:系统找不到指定的路径。Error: JAVA_HOME is incorrectly set. Please update D:\

问题描述当我们在Win10操作系统下安装hadoop时,输入hadoopversion,我们可能会遇到以下这种问题: 但是检查java时:hadoop的环境变量也没问题。这时候,多半是因为你的java环境变量路径含有空格 这时候建议最好不要去修改你的java路径,重新设置环境变量非常的麻烦,你大概率会得到其中涉及到注册表的问题使得整个问题不断复杂化,holdon!! 问题解决1.首先,我们找到C:\hadoop\hadoop-3.2.2\etc\hadoop这个目录下的hadoop-env.cmd这个命令脚本。(自己装在哪个目录下,就往哪个目录找) 2.然后,右键,编辑,进入编辑页面3.将你的

php - ini_set, set_time_limit, (max_execution_time) - 不工作

如果我执行set_time_limit(50)或ini_set('max_execution_time',50),那么当我回显ini_get('max_execution_time')在我的本地主机上,我得到50,但是当我在另一台服务器上执行此操作时,它会回显默认的30并完全忽略我的请求。这是为什么呢? 最佳答案 Youcannotchangethissettingwithini_set()whenrunninginsafemode.Theonlyworkaroundistoturnoffsafemodeorbychangingth

php - ini_set, set_time_limit, (max_execution_time) - 不工作

如果我执行set_time_limit(50)或ini_set('max_execution_time',50),那么当我回显ini_get('max_execution_time')在我的本地主机上,我得到50,但是当我在另一台服务器上执行此操作时,它会回显默认的30并完全忽略我的请求。这是为什么呢? 最佳答案 Youcannotchangethissettingwithini_set()whenrunninginsafemode.Theonlyworkaroundistoturnoffsafemodeorbychangingth

mysql - 从 SET 字段中删除值的最佳方法?

更新mysqlSET字段的最佳方法是从字段中删除特定值。例如。具有以下值的字段类别:1、2、3、4、5?我想从列表中删除“2”:UPDATEtableSETcategories=REPLACE(categories,',2,',',')WHEREfieldLIKE'%,2,%';但是如果“2”是列表中的第一个或最后一个值呢?UPDATEtableSETcategories=REPLACE(categories,'2,','')WHEREfieldLIKE'2,%';UPDATEtableSETcategories=REPLACE(categories,',2','')WHEREfiel

mysql - 从 SET 字段中删除值的最佳方法?

更新mysqlSET字段的最佳方法是从字段中删除特定值。例如。具有以下值的字段类别:1、2、3、4、5?我想从列表中删除“2”:UPDATEtableSETcategories=REPLACE(categories,',2,',',')WHEREfieldLIKE'%,2,%';但是如果“2”是列表中的第一个或最后一个值呢?UPDATEtableSETcategories=REPLACE(categories,'2,','')WHEREfieldLIKE'2,%';UPDATEtableSETcategories=REPLACE(categories,',2','')WHEREfiel

mysql - character_set_connection 的目的是什么?

只需阅读StefanGehrig对Is"SETCHARACTERSETutf8"necessary?的出色回答,在解释解释和运行查询w.r.t的阶段方面比MySQL的文档更进一步。字符集和排序规则,但我仍然无法真正理解character_set_connection的用途,或者更具体地说,将语句从character_set_client转码为character_set_connection。为什么不直接使用character_set_client进行查询,并在与列值比较时直接从character_set_client转码为列的字符集?这个中间阶段的目的是什么?该手册给出了比较文字字符串

mysql - character_set_connection 的目的是什么?

只需阅读StefanGehrig对Is"SETCHARACTERSETutf8"necessary?的出色回答,在解释解释和运行查询w.r.t的阶段方面比MySQL的文档更进一步。字符集和排序规则,但我仍然无法真正理解character_set_connection的用途,或者更具体地说,将语句从character_set_client转码为character_set_connection。为什么不直接使用character_set_client进行查询,并在与列值比较时直接从character_set_client转码为列的字符集?这个中间阶段的目的是什么?该手册给出了比较文字字符串

mysql - SET GLOBAL max_allowed_pa​​cket 不起作用

这个问题在这里已经有了答案:Howtochangemax_allowed_packetsize(14个回答)关闭去年。我发现了如何使用SETGLOBAL在MySQL中更改max_allowed_pa​​cket的默认值。但是,每次我使用这个命令时,默认值都保持不变!我使用了这些命令:mysql--user=root--password=mypassmysql>SETGLOBALmax_allowed_packet=32*1024*1024;QueryOK,0rowsaffected(0.00secs)mysql>SHOWVARIABLESmax_allowed_packet;然后结果是

mysql - SET GLOBAL max_allowed_pa​​cket 不起作用

这个问题在这里已经有了答案:Howtochangemax_allowed_packetsize(14个回答)关闭去年。我发现了如何使用SETGLOBAL在MySQL中更改max_allowed_pa​​cket的默认值。但是,每次我使用这个命令时,默认值都保持不变!我使用了这些命令:mysql--user=root--password=mypassmysql>SETGLOBALmax_allowed_packet=32*1024*1024;QueryOK,0rowsaffected(0.00secs)mysql>SHOWVARIABLESmax_allowed_packet;然后结果是

mysql - 如何在 my.ini 中将 character_set_database 和 collat​​ion_database 设置为 utf8?

我已经用谷歌搜索了很多关于这个问题的信息。总而言之,这就是我的my.ini的样子:s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ES[client]database=abcdefuser=rootpassword=XXXXXXdefault-character-set=utf8[mysql]default-character-set=utf8[mysqld]character_set_server=utf8max_connections=200init_connect='SETcollation_connection=utf8_gen